mission--Setting the Standard ?Penske Lays the Foundation for Measurable Results

Penske’s first task was to establish key performance and financial indicators (KPIs and KFIs) as benchmarks for measuring success.  To do this, Penske became a participating member of Mission Foods?budgeting team.  Partnering with the same people responsible for evaluating the overall financial performance of each plant allowed Penske to quickly identify areas of joint concern.

Together, Penske and Mission Foods established benchmarks, such as transportation cost per pound, variable impact of volume, cube utilization per trailer, average miles per gallon of fuel and transportation delay times.  Using these benchmarks, plant inefficiencies or problem areas would be immediately apparent to the organization, allowing Penske to resolve transportation issues with minimal financial impact.

After establishing KPIs and KFIs, Penske next task was to implement uniform technologies and tools that would track and measure each indicator.  Penske proprietary Logistics Management System software would be implemented at every plant.

Using these technologies, Penske would be able to centralize management of freight, carriers and information throughout the transportation network.  Transportation information would be shared throughout Mission Foods?manufacturing and sales organizations.  Visibility of inbound and outbound shipments would be increased, allowing Mission Foods to track, anticipate and avoid shipping delays.

As Penske took over transportation operations at each plant, it began working with the plant existing staff on the use of new technologies.  Penske also worked closely with the company purchasing organization to instill new ordering processes that communicated order quantities, priorities and required delivery times throughout Mission Foods?production and transportation operations.
